«Если рабочий хочет хорошо выполнять свою работу, он должен сначала заточить свои инструменты» — Конфуций, «Аналитики Конфуция. Лу Лингун»
титульная страница > программирование > Понимание CSS-фреймворков

Понимание CSS-фреймворков

Опубликовано 30 июля 2024 г.
Просматривать:368

Understanding CSS Frameworks

CSS-фреймворки произвели революцию в веб-дизайне, предоставив предварительно написанные модули кода многократного использования для стилизации веб-страниц. Эти фреймворки предлагают структурированный и организованный способ создания эстетически привлекательных и адаптивных веб-сайтов без написания CSS с нуля.
Ключевые особенности CSS-фреймворков
Системы сеток. Большинство фреймворков CSS имеют встроенные системы сеток, которые позволяют создавать гибкие и отзывчивые макеты. Эта функция упрощает процесс расположения элементов на странице, гарантируя, что они легко адаптируются к экранам разных размеров.

**Предварительно разработанные компоненты:
**CSS-фреймворки включают в себя множество предварительно разработанных компонентов пользовательского интерфейса, таких как кнопки, формы, панели навигации, модальные окна и многое другое. Эти компоненты соответствуют лучшим практикам проектирования и могут быть легко настроены.

**Кроссбраузерная совместимость:
**Фреймворки разработаны с учетом кросс-браузерной совместимости, что снижает необходимость написания собственного CSS для обработки различий между браузерами.

**Настройка:
**Хотя CSS-фреймворки имеют стили по умолчанию, они обладают широкими возможностями настройки. Разработчики могут переопределять стили по умолчанию или расширять структуру в соответствии с конкретными потребностями дизайна.

**Популярные CSS-фреймворки
**Bootstrap: Bootstrap, одна из наиболее широко используемых фреймворков CSS, предлагает обширную документацию и большое сообщество. Он включает в себя надежную сетку, возможности адаптивного дизайна и множество компонентов.

Фундамент:
Foundation, известный своей гибкостью и настраиваемостью, является еще одним популярным выбором. Он предоставляет расширенные функции, такие как адаптивная типографика, сложные параметры макета и поддержка Sass, препроцессора CSS.

**Бульма:
**Современный CSS-фреймворк, основанный на Flexbox, Bulma подчеркивает простоту и удобство использования. Он предлагает понятный и читаемый синтаксис, что делает его идеальным для разработчиков, предпочитающих простой подход.

**CSS попутного ветра:
**В отличие от традиционных фреймворков CSS, Tailwind CSS ориентирован на утилиты, то есть предоставляет низкоуровневые служебные классы, которые можно комбинировать для создания собственных проектов. Этот подход обеспечивает больший контроль над дизайном при сохранении единообразия.

**Преимущества использования CSS Framework

**Скорость и эффективность:
Фреймворки ускоряют процесс разработки, предоставляя готовые компоненты и стили. Это позволяет разработчикам больше сосредоточиться на функциональности, а не тратить время на базовый стиль.

Последовательность:
Использование структуры обеспечивает согласованность дизайна на разных страницах и компонентах, что приводит к более сплоченному пользовательскому интерфейсу.

**Адаптивный дизайн:
**Большинство CSS-фреймворков построены по принципу «мобильность прежде всего», что гарантирует адаптивность веб-сайтов и их хорошую работу на различных устройствах.

**Поддержка сообщества:
**Популярные платформы имеют обширную документацию и активные сообщества, что упрощает поиск решений проблем, обмен советами и доступ к сторонним плагинам и расширениям.

**Уменьшение проблем с кроссбраузерностью:
**Фреймворки устраняют многие особенности, связанные с различными браузерами, что снижает необходимость в тщательном кроссбраузерном тестировании и исправлении ошибок.

Заключение:
Фреймворки CSS предоставляют эффективный и действенный способ стилизации веб-приложений, предлагая баланс структуры, гибкости и согласованности. Независимо от того, создаете ли вы прототип нового проекта или разрабатываете сложное веб-приложение, платформа CSS может значительно упростить ваш рабочий процесс и улучшить общее качество вашего дизайна.

Для получения более подробной информации вы можете прочитать далее, нажав здесь.

Заявление о выпуске Эта статья воспроизведена по адресу: https://dev.to/hammad_hassan_6e981aa049b/understanding-css-frameworks-68e?1. Если обнаружено какое-либо нарушение прав, свяжитесь с [email protected], чтобы удалить ее.
Последний учебник Более>

Изучайте китайский

Отказ от ответственности: Все предоставленные ресурсы частично взяты из Интернета. В случае нарушения ваших авторских прав или других прав и интересов, пожалуйста, объясните подробные причины и предоставьте доказательства авторских прав или прав и интересов, а затем отправьте их по электронной почте: [email protected]. Мы сделаем это за вас как можно скорее.

Copyright© 2022 湘ICP备2022001581号-3